author | Robert O'Callahan <robert@ocallahan.org> |
Fri, 03 Jan 2014 14:48:12 +1300 | |
changeset 166620 | 67ff9392766b53c51bb876b5f74e5e6602347668 |
parent 166619 | 3c354b68a0cad21b266314c6d1f0f947f579963e |
child 166621 | 215f5bc6284dfc1778d01ae0fe52a9ea96d6bf2a |
push id | unknown |
push user | unknown |
push date | unknown |
reviewers | ms2ger |
bugs | 946065 |
milestone | 29.0a1 |
first release with | n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
|
last release without | n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
|
--- a/content/base/src/moz.build +++ b/content/base/src/moz.build @@ -195,23 +195,23 @@ FINAL_LIBRARY = 'gklayout' LOCAL_INCLUDES += [ '/caps/include', '/content/events/src', '/content/html/content/src', '/content/html/document/src', '/content/xbl/src', '/content/xml/content/src', '/content/xml/document/src', - '/content/xslt/src/xpath', '/content/xul/content/src', '/content/xul/document/src', '/docshell/base', '/dom/base', '/dom/ipc', '/dom/workers', + '/dom/xslt/xpath', '/image/src', '/js/ipc', '/js/xpconnect/src', '/js/xpconnect/wrappers', '/layout/base', '/layout/generic', '/layout/style', '/layout/svg',
--- a/content/moz.build +++ b/content/moz.build @@ -11,13 +11,12 @@ PARALLEL_DIRS += [ 'html', 'mathml/content/src', 'media', 'smil', 'svg', 'xml', 'xul', 'xbl', - 'xslt', ] TEST_TOOL_DIRS += ['test']
deleted file mode 100644 --- a/content/xslt/moz.build +++ /dev/null @@ -1,8 +0,0 @@ -# -*- Mode: python; c-basic-offset: 4; indent-tabs-mode: nil; tab-width: 40 -*- -# vim: set filetype=python: -# This Source Code Form is subject to the terms of the Mozilla Public -# License, v. 2.0. If a copy of the MPL was not distributed with this -# file, You can obtain one at http://mozilla.org/MPL/2.0/. - -PARALLEL_DIRS += ['public', 'src'] -TEST_DIRS += ['tests/buster', 'tests/mochitest']
deleted file mode 100644 --- a/content/xslt/src/moz.build +++ /dev/null @@ -1,7 +0,0 @@ -# -*- Mode: python; c-basic-offset: 4; indent-tabs-mode: nil; tab-width: 40 -*- -# vim: set filetype=python: -# This Source Code Form is subject to the terms of the Mozilla Public -# License, v. 2.0. If a copy of the MPL was not distributed with this -# file, You can obtain one at http://mozilla.org/MPL/2.0/. - -PARALLEL_DIRS += ['base', 'xml', 'xpath', 'xslt']
--- a/dom/bindings/moz.build +++ b/dom/bindings/moz.build @@ -43,28 +43,28 @@ LOCAL_INCLUDES += [ '/content/events/src', '/content/html/content/src', '/content/html/document/src', '/content/media/webaudio', '/content/media/webspeech/recognition', '/content/svg/content/src', '/content/xbl/src', '/content/xml/content/src', - '/content/xslt/src/base', - '/content/xslt/src/xpath', '/content/xul/content/src', '/content/xul/document/src', '/dom/base', '/dom/battery', '/dom/bluetooth', '/dom/camera', '/dom/file', '/dom/indexedDB', '/dom/src/geolocation', '/dom/workers', + '/dom/xslt/base', + '/dom/xslt/xpath', '/js/ipc', '/js/xpconnect/src', '/js/xpconnect/wrappers', '/layout/style', '/layout/xul/tree', '/media/mtransport', '/media/webrtc/signaling/src/common/time_profiling', '/media/webrtc/signaling/src/peerconnection',
--- a/dom/moz.build +++ b/dom/moz.build @@ -71,16 +71,17 @@ PARALLEL_DIRS += [ 'identity', 'workers', 'camera', 'audiochannel', 'promise', 'telephony', 'inputmethod', 'webidl', + 'xslt', ] if CONFIG['OS_ARCH'] == 'WINNT': PARALLEL_DIRS += ['plugins/ipc/hangui'] if CONFIG['MOZ_WIDGET_TOOLKIT'] == 'gonk': PARALLEL_DIRS += [ 'speakermanager',
rename from content/xslt/src/base/moz.build rename to dom/xslt/base/moz.build --- a/content/xslt/src/base/moz.build +++ b/dom/xslt/base/moz.build @@ -10,15 +10,15 @@ UNIFIED_SOURCES += [ 'txList.cpp', 'txNamespaceMap.cpp', 'txURIUtils.cpp', ] FAIL_ON_WARNINGS = True LOCAL_INCLUDES += [ - '../../public', + '..', '../xml', '../xpath', '../xslt', ] FINAL_LIBRARY = 'gklayout'
rename from content/xslt/src/base/txExpandedNameMap.cpp rename to dom/xslt/base/txExpandedNameMap.cpp
rename from content/xslt/crashtests/182460-select.xml rename to dom/xslt/crashtests/182460-select.xml
rename from content/xslt/crashtests/182460-selects.xsl rename to dom/xslt/crashtests/182460-selects.xsl
rename from content/xslt/crashtests/182460-table.xhtml rename to dom/xslt/crashtests/182460-table.xhtml
rename from content/xslt/public/moz.build rename to dom/xslt/moz.build --- a/content/xslt/public/moz.build +++ b/dom/xslt/moz.build @@ -15,8 +15,19 @@ XPIDL_SOURCES += [ ] XPIDL_MODULE = 'content_xslt' EXPORTS += [ 'nsIDocumentTransformer.h', ] +PARALLEL_DIRS += [ + 'base', + 'xml', + 'xpath', + 'xslt', +] + +TEST_DIRS += [ + 'tests/buster', + 'tests/mochitest', +]
rename from content/xslt/public/nsIDocumentTransformer.h rename to dom/xslt/nsIDocumentTransformer.h
rename from content/xslt/public/nsIXSLTProcessorPrivate.idl rename to dom/xslt/nsIXSLTProcessorPrivate.idl
rename from content/xslt/tests/XSLTMark/XSLTMark-static.js rename to dom/xslt/tests/XSLTMark/XSLTMark-static.js
rename from content/xslt/tests/XSLTMark/XSLTMark-test.js rename to dom/xslt/tests/XSLTMark/XSLTMark-test.js
rename from content/xslt/tests/XSLTMark/XSLTMark-view.js rename to dom/xslt/tests/XSLTMark/XSLTMark-view.js
rename from content/xslt/tests/buster/buster-files.js rename to dom/xslt/tests/buster/buster-files.js
rename from content/xslt/tests/buster/buster-handlers.js rename to dom/xslt/tests/buster/buster-handlers.js
rename from content/xslt/tests/buster/buster-statics.js rename to dom/xslt/tests/buster/buster-statics.js
rename from content/xslt/tests/buster/helper/generate-rdf.pl rename to dom/xslt/tests/buster/helper/generate-rdf.pl
rename from content/xslt/tests/buster/result-inspector.xul rename to dom/xslt/tests/buster/result-inspector.xul
rename from content/xslt/tests/buster/result-view.css rename to dom/xslt/tests/buster/result-view.css
rename from content/xslt/tests/buster/result-view.xul rename to dom/xslt/tests/buster/result-view.xul
rename from content/xslt/tests/buster/xslt-qa-overlay.js rename to dom/xslt/tests/buster/xslt-qa-overlay.js
rename from content/xslt/tests/buster/xslt-qa-overlay.xul rename to dom/xslt/tests/buster/xslt-qa-overlay.xul
rename from content/xslt/tests/mochitest/mochitest.ini rename to dom/xslt/tests/mochitest/mochitest.ini
rename from content/xslt/tests/mochitest/test_bug319374.xhtml rename to dom/xslt/tests/mochitest/test_bug319374.xhtml
rename from content/xslt/tests/mochitest/test_bug427060.html rename to dom/xslt/tests/mochitest/test_bug427060.html
rename from content/xslt/tests/mochitest/test_bug440974.html rename to dom/xslt/tests/mochitest/test_bug440974.html
rename from content/xslt/tests/mochitest/test_bug453441.html rename to dom/xslt/tests/mochitest/test_bug453441.html
rename from content/xslt/tests/mochitest/test_bug468208.html rename to dom/xslt/tests/mochitest/test_bug468208.html
rename from content/xslt/tests/mochitest/test_bug511487.html rename to dom/xslt/tests/mochitest/test_bug511487.html
rename from content/xslt/tests/mochitest/test_bug551412.html rename to dom/xslt/tests/mochitest/test_bug551412.html
rename from content/xslt/tests/mochitest/test_bug551654.html rename to dom/xslt/tests/mochitest/test_bug551654.html
rename from content/xslt/tests/mochitest/test_bug566629.html rename to dom/xslt/tests/mochitest/test_bug566629.html
rename from content/xslt/tests/mochitest/test_bug566629.xhtml rename to dom/xslt/tests/mochitest/test_bug566629.xhtml
rename from content/xslt/tests/mochitest/test_bug603159.html rename to dom/xslt/tests/mochitest/test_bug603159.html
rename from content/xslt/tests/mochitest/test_bug616774.html rename to dom/xslt/tests/mochitest/test_bug616774.html
rename from content/xslt/tests/mochitest/test_bug667315.html rename to dom/xslt/tests/mochitest/test_bug667315.html
rename from content/xslt/tests/mochitest/test_exslt_regex.html rename to dom/xslt/tests/mochitest/test_exslt_regex.html
rename from content/xslt/public/txIEXSLTRegExFunctions.idl rename to dom/xslt/txIEXSLTRegExFunctions.idl
rename from content/xslt/public/txIFunctionEvaluationContext.idl rename to dom/xslt/txIFunctionEvaluationContext.idl
rename from content/xslt/src/xpath/nsXPathExpression.cpp rename to dom/xslt/xpath/nsXPathExpression.cpp
rename from content/xslt/src/xpath/nsXPathNSResolver.cpp rename to dom/xslt/xpath/nsXPathNSResolver.cpp
rename from content/xslt/src/xpath/txCoreFunctionCall.cpp rename to dom/xslt/xpath/txCoreFunctionCall.cpp
rename from content/xslt/src/xpath/txForwardContext.cpp rename to dom/xslt/xpath/txForwardContext.cpp
rename from content/xslt/src/xpath/txMozillaXPathTreeWalker.cpp rename to dom/xslt/xpath/txMozillaXPathTreeWalker.cpp
rename from content/xslt/src/xpath/txNamedAttributeStep.cpp rename to dom/xslt/xpath/txNamedAttributeStep.cpp
rename from content/xslt/src/xpath/txNodeSetAdaptor.cpp rename to dom/xslt/xpath/txNodeSetAdaptor.cpp
rename from content/xslt/src/xpath/txNodeSetContext.cpp rename to dom/xslt/xpath/txNodeSetContext.cpp
rename from content/xslt/src/xpath/txPredicatedNodeTest.cpp rename to dom/xslt/xpath/txPredicatedNodeTest.cpp
rename from content/xslt/src/xpath/txRelationalExpr.cpp rename to dom/xslt/xpath/txRelationalExpr.cpp
rename from content/xslt/src/xpath/txResultRecycler.cpp rename to dom/xslt/xpath/txResultRecycler.cpp
rename from content/xslt/src/xpath/txSingleNodeContext.h rename to dom/xslt/xpath/txSingleNodeContext.h
rename from content/xslt/src/xpath/txVariableRefExpr.cpp rename to dom/xslt/xpath/txVariableRefExpr.cpp
rename from content/xslt/src/xpath/txXPCOMExtensionFunction.cpp rename to dom/xslt/xpath/txXPCOMExtensionFunction.cpp
rename from content/xslt/src/xpath/txXPathObjectAdaptor.h rename to dom/xslt/xpath/txXPathObjectAdaptor.h
rename from content/xslt/src/xpath/txXPathOptimizer.cpp rename to dom/xslt/xpath/txXPathOptimizer.cpp
rename from content/xslt/src/xslt/txBufferingHandler.cpp rename to dom/xslt/xslt/txBufferingHandler.cpp
rename from content/xslt/src/xslt/txCurrentFunctionCall.cpp rename to dom/xslt/xslt/txCurrentFunctionCall.cpp
rename from content/xslt/src/xslt/txDocumentFunctionCall.cpp rename to dom/xslt/xslt/txDocumentFunctionCall.cpp
rename from content/xslt/src/xslt/txEXSLTRegExFunctions.js rename to dom/xslt/xslt/txEXSLTRegExFunctions.js
rename from content/xslt/src/xslt/txEXSLTRegExFunctions.manifest rename to dom/xslt/xslt/txEXSLTRegExFunctions.manifest
rename from content/xslt/src/xslt/txFormatNumberFunctionCall.cpp rename to dom/xslt/xslt/txFormatNumberFunctionCall.cpp
rename from content/xslt/src/xslt/txGenerateIdFunctionCall.cpp rename to dom/xslt/xslt/txGenerateIdFunctionCall.cpp
rename from content/xslt/src/xslt/txKeyFunctionCall.cpp rename to dom/xslt/xslt/txKeyFunctionCall.cpp
rename from content/xslt/src/xslt/txMozillaStylesheetCompiler.cpp rename to dom/xslt/xslt/txMozillaStylesheetCompiler.cpp
rename from content/xslt/src/xslt/txMozillaTextOutput.cpp rename to dom/xslt/xslt/txMozillaTextOutput.cpp
rename from content/xslt/src/xslt/txMozillaTextOutput.h rename to dom/xslt/xslt/txMozillaTextOutput.h
rename from content/xslt/src/xslt/txMozillaXMLOutput.cpp rename to dom/xslt/xslt/txMozillaXMLOutput.cpp
rename from content/xslt/src/xslt/txMozillaXSLTProcessor.cpp rename to dom/xslt/xslt/txMozillaXSLTProcessor.cpp
rename from content/xslt/src/xslt/txMozillaXSLTProcessor.h rename to dom/xslt/xslt/txMozillaXSLTProcessor.h
rename from content/xslt/src/xslt/txPatternOptimizer.cpp rename to dom/xslt/xslt/txPatternOptimizer.cpp
rename from content/xslt/src/xslt/txStylesheetCompileHandlers.cpp rename to dom/xslt/xslt/txStylesheetCompileHandlers.cpp
rename from content/xslt/src/xslt/txStylesheetCompileHandlers.h rename to dom/xslt/xslt/txStylesheetCompileHandlers.h
rename from content/xslt/src/xslt/txStylesheetCompiler.cpp rename to dom/xslt/xslt/txStylesheetCompiler.cpp
rename from content/xslt/src/xslt/txStylesheetCompiler.h rename to dom/xslt/xslt/txStylesheetCompiler.h
rename from content/xslt/src/xslt/txXPathResultComparator.cpp rename to dom/xslt/xslt/txXPathResultComparator.cpp
rename from content/xslt/src/xslt/txXPathResultComparator.h rename to dom/xslt/xslt/txXPathResultComparator.h
rename from content/xslt/src/xslt/txXSLTEnvironmentFunctionCall.cpp rename to dom/xslt/xslt/txXSLTEnvironmentFunctionCall.cpp
rename from content/xslt/src/xslt/txXSLTNumberCounters.cpp rename to dom/xslt/xslt/txXSLTNumberCounters.cpp
--- a/layout/build/moz.build +++ b/layout/build/moz.build @@ -41,36 +41,36 @@ LOCAL_INCLUDES += [ '/caps/include', '/content/base/src', '/content/canvas/src', '/content/events/src', '/content/html/content/src', '/content/html/document/src', '/content/svg/content/src', '/content/xbl/src', - '/content/xslt/src/base', - '/content/xslt/src/xml', - '/content/xslt/src/xpath', - '/content/xslt/src/xslt', '/content/xul/content/src', '/content/xul/document/src', '/content/xul/templates/src', '/docshell/base', '/dom/audiochannel', '/dom/base', '/dom/camera', '/dom/file', '/dom/media', '/dom/speakermanager', '/dom/src/geolocation', '/dom/src/json', '/dom/src/jsurl', '/dom/src/offline', '/dom/src/storage', '/dom/telephony', + '/dom/xslt/base', + '/dom/xslt/xml', + '/dom/xslt/xpath', + '/dom/xslt/xslt', '/editor/composer/src', '/editor/libeditor/base', '/editor/libeditor/html', '/editor/libeditor/text', '/editor/txmgr/src', '/editor/txtsvc/src', '/extensions/cookie', '/js/xpconnect/loader',
--- a/testing/crashtest/crashtests.list +++ b/testing/crashtest/crashtests.list @@ -10,30 +10,30 @@ include ../../content/canvas/crashtests/ include ../../content/events/crashtests/crashtests.list include ../../content/html/document/crashtests/crashtests.list include ../../content/html/content/crashtests/crashtests.list include ../../content/smil/crashtests/crashtests.list include ../../content/svg/content/src/crashtests/crashtests.list include ../../content/xml/content/crashtest/crashtests.list include ../../content/xml/document/crashtests/crashtests.list include ../../content/xbl/crashtests/crashtests.list -include ../../content/xslt/crashtests/crashtests.list include ../../content/xul/content/crashtests/crashtests.list include ../../content/xul/document/crashtests/crashtests.list include ../../content/xul/templates/src/crashtests/crashtests.list include ../../content/mathml/content/crashtests/crashtests.list # Bug 868152 - webaudio crash on tegra platform skip-if(Android) include ../../content/media/test/crashtests/crashtests.list include ../../docshell/base/crashtests/crashtests.list include ../../dom/base/crashtests/crashtests.list include ../../dom/bindings/crashtests/crashtests.list include ../../dom/indexedDB/crashtests/crashtests.list +include ../../dom/xslt/crashtests/crashtests.list # Bug 811873 - mozRTCPeerConnection doesn't support remote browser yet skip-if(B2G||browserIsRemote) include ../../dom/media/tests/crashtests/crashtests.list include ../../dom/src/offline/crashtests/crashtests.list include ../../dom/src/jsurl/crashtests/crashtests.list include ../../editor/crashtests.list